Responsibilities
  • Develop the scope of work and design, and manage planning, pre-construction, construction, closeout, and follow-up phases.
  • Develop, monitor, adapt, and communicate building phasing schedules, including progress, delays, and conflicts.
  • Read plans, perform takeoffs, and identify potential issues.
  • Develop critical paths and manage project schedules and budgets.
  • Manage client, subcontractor, vendor, hotel ownership, APM, superintendent, and field-team relationships.
  • Use AIA documents, requests for information, and submittals.
  • Create room out-of-order matrices.
  • Manage pre-construction activities, project kickoff, project execution, and project closeout.
  • Manage change orders and maintain accurate change-order logs with field teams and ownership.
  • Run and manage ongoing and final punch lists with superintendents and field management.
  • Manage project closeout, including final budget analysis, change-order closeout, and on-site project completion checklists.
  • Coordinate furniture, fixtures, and equipment and material receiving, inventory, and installation.
  • Monitor and communicate scopes of work for individual subcontractors.
  • Execute owner contracts, statements of work, AFPs, SOVs, and lien waivers.
  • Initiate and lead regular meetings with hotel ownership.
  • Ensure safety and Occupational Safety and Health Administration compliance with in-field teams.
  • Maintain clean and safe working conditions.
  • Adhere to major hotel brand standards and understand and facilitate hotel operations.

Hotel Rehabs renovates branded and independent boutique hotels nationwide, working on projects for Hilton, IHG, Marriott, and Hyatt in upper mid-scale to upper upscale segments. It manages renovations from planning through completion, coordinating with brand requirements and property needs to refresh guest rooms and public spaces. The company is a tightly held firm that emphasizes strong relationships, with a nationwide footprint and extensive experience delivering large guestrooms projects for major brands. Its goal is to complete renovations efficiently while maintaining relationships with owners and brands and improving guest experience across the country.

What makes Hotel Rehabs unique

  • Since 2010, Hotel Rehabs completed 110 projects across 33 states and 15,900 guestrooms.
  • It specializes in turn-key branded renovations for Marriott, Hilton, Hyatt, and IHG properties.
  • Chicago headquarters plus Cincinnati, Phoenix, and Mexico City support nationwide execution.
